No RROD: Overheating prompts the Xbox 360 slim to shut down

June 21, 2010 by Gameranx Staff

Xbox 360 slim overheating – The Xbox 360 is shutting down to protect the console from insufficient ventilation.

Xbox 360 slim rrod

Microsoft has already promised that there won’t be any RRODs on the new Xbox 360 Slim, announced at E3 2010, but an interesting tidbit of info has come to our attention. When the system overheats, instead of the dreaded “RROD” a message will appear on the screen.


The Xbox 360 is shutting down to protect the console from insufficient ventilation. You can turn the console back on after the power light stops flashing.

As documented in the past, it seems like the internal architecture of the Xbox 360 is just prone to overheating, so in order to prevent that from happening, the new “Xbox 360 Slim” will just make you wait for a few minutes until the power light stops flashing. We understand the fact that this could serve as a hindrance during your “epic gameplay moment,” but if you ask us, it’s better to give your Xbox 360 a 5-10 minutes break instead of waiting a month for a replacement or fix.
